Notes:

In 2027, ANZAC Day falls on a Sunday. In Tasmania, there is no additional public holiday for ANZAC Day when it falls on a weekend.

*Devonport Cup Public Holiday is generally State Public Service only and observed for half a day in the municipal area of Devonport, Latrobe, City of Burnie, Waratah, Wynyard, Circular Head, Central Coast, West Coast and Kentish.

**Royal Hobart Regatta Public Holiday is observed in regions south of & including Oatlands and Swansea excluding Bronte Park, Catagunya, Strathgordon, Tarraleah, Wayatinah & West Coast.

***Launceston Cup Public Holiday is generally the Public Service only and is observed all day in the municipal areas of Break O’Day, Dorset, George Town, Glamorgan-Spring Bay (north of and including Cranbrook), Launceston excluding Launceston City centre and suburbs specified below, Meander Valley excluding suburbs and townships specified below, Northern Midlands, Southern Midlands north of but not including Oatlands, West Tamar excluding townships specified below. From 11.00 a.m. – Launceston City centre and the following suburbs and townships Alanvale, Blackstone Heights, East Launceston, Elphin, Franklin Village, Glen Dhu, Inveresk, Invermay, Killafaddy, Kings Meadows, Mayfield, Mowbray, Mowbray Heights, Newnham, Newstead, North Riverside, Norwood, Prospect, Prospect Vale, Punchbowl, Ravenswood, Riverside, Rocherlea, St Leonards, Sandhill, South Launceston, Summerhill, Trevallyn, Vermont, Waverley, West Launceston, West Riverside, Youngtown.

****Recreation Day is observed by all areas in Northern Tasmania excluding Oatlands & Swansea. Recreation Day is intended to offset Royal Hobart Regatta Day which is observed in Hobart.

*****In 2027, Christmas Day falls on a Saturday. As a result, there is an additional public holiday on Monday, 27 December 2027.

******In 2027, Boxing Day falls on a Sunday. As a result, there is an additional public holiday on Tuesday, 28 December 2027.

The Queen’s Birthday public holiday has been replaced by the King’s Birthday public holiday.
